An extremely rare phenomenon in the Rhodopes. In one of the hunting farms, a snow-white albino roe deer was spotted high in the mountains. It has appeared around places where food is left for wild animals during the cold months.

The number of people who have seen the rare white doe can be counted on the fingers. Among the lucky few is the experienced wildlife photographer Tsvetomir Tsolov, who managed to capture the albino up close. “A white doe, not only on the territory of our country, but also worldwide, is extremely rare to see. Mathematically, you can’t say one in a million or one in a few million. For me, these photos are the best luck I’ve had in the forest,” he shares.

The unique shots were shot at the cost of a lot of coldness and enviable patience. “In the morning the temperature was minus 9 degrees, reaching a maximum of about 1 degree. I spent 8 hours and 25 minutes in the shelter. Without any heating, just with the equipment. It was only at six o’clock that I started to get up and move around a little inside”, explains the photographer.

It wasn’t until the fourth hour in the shelter that the white animal timidly peeked out of the forest and came out by the feeder. At such a time, even the slightest noise can drive him back.

You’re probably waiting to learn exactly where that white doe was spotted. However, we will deliberately hide its location. Not for anything else, but to protect this natural phenomenon from unscrupulous hunters.

Our team goes to the heart of the Rhodopes. After hours of hard climbing on dirt roads, it climbs high into the mountains. The approaching spring has melted the snow and the animals show their muzzles in the open less and less. The chance of seeing them, even if only briefly, is greater in the built shelters around the feeders. Finally, our camera managed to capture 3 roe deer that almost came to pose in front of her.

Roe deer roam around the food left behind. One of the activities of the game farms is to take care of the animals in the months when the thick snow makes finding food difficult. Specialists carefully monitor the animals – their number, age and behavior. Photo traps are also used, which take pictures of any movement around the feeders. Continuous monitoring allows better planning of population development.

Albino is the result of inbreeding. It appears to be at least 5 years old. During that time, however, no one has seen him anywhere. It cannot have come from far away, as roe deer are settled animals with a narrow range. “Probably the more hidden way of life, the more closed way of life, especially of the roe deer, has allowed it not to be seen and to survive in nature”, suggests engineer Zdravko Bakalov from the SDP.

The variety of fauna in the Rhodopes is among the many reasons to go for a walk in the mountains. Wild animals rarely allow people near them, and it is generally not desirable to disturb them. On the other hand, the picturesque mountain hills offer enough hiking routes outside the hunting grounds.

If we choose Velingrad as a starting point, there are dozens of paths to the surrounding hills. Nestled in the Chepin Valley, the town is a gateway to the precipices of Pasovo skali, to the green pastures of Yundola and to a whole cascade of dams. Very close to Velingrad is the geographical point where the 24th meridian and the 42nd parallel intersect. The only narrow-gauge railway in our country also passes through the city, winding along the narrow gorges to the majestic Rila and Pirin.
